Federal Report Cards provide detailed information about the performance of schools, districts, and states as required by the Every Student Succeeds Act (ESSA). The report card includes data on:
State Accountability Systems: Details about the state's accountability system under ESSA.
Student Achievement: Performance on state assessments in Reading/Language Arts, Math, and Science (by grade level and subgroup).
Academic Growth: Progress of students over time in meeting grade-level expectations.
Graduation Rates: Four-year and extended-year graduation rates for high schools.
English Language Proficiency: Progress of English Learners (ELs) toward proficiency in English.
School Quality or Student Success: Indicators such as student attendance, college readiness, and participation in advanced coursework.
Teacher Qualifications: Percentage of teachers meeting certification and professional qualifications. Percentage of teachers who are teaching out-of-field or under emergency certification.
Per-Pupil Expenditure: Total funding spent per student at both the school and district level.
